Cutting Aluminum with a Miter Saw

Successfully machining aluminum with a compound saw requires a somewhat different method than cutting wood. Alu tends to bind to saw blades, which can lead to distortion and poor sections. To lessen this, incorporating a coolant like WD-40 is vital. Spread the coolant immediately to the edge and the alu workpiece before each pass. Furthermore, consider using a fine-tooth edge particularly designed for metal materials – a more durable blade will even help avoid binding. Finally, advance the aluminum slowly through the saw, allowing the tooth to do the work without pushing it.

Selecting the Right Miter Saw for Metal

Working with metal profiles demands a miter saw designed of delivering clean, accurate cuts without damaging the stock. Standard miter saws, often built for wood, can easily tear out or chip aluminum, leading to a uneven finish and wasted sections. Therefore, precise consideration should be given to key features. Look for a saw with a high tooth count blade – ideally over 60 teeth – specifically designed for non-ferrous metals. Cutting speed is also critical; lower RPMs generally lead in a cleaner cut and minimize friction. Consider a sliding miter saw if you frequently need to cut bulkier aluminium sections, offering increased cutting capacity. Ultimately, the optimal choice hinges on your task requirements and your spending limits.
